Females' Enrollment and Completion in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ics Massive Open Online Courses.

2016 
Massive Open Online Courses (MOOCs) have the potential to democratize education by providing learners with access to rich sources of information. However, evidence supporting this democratization across countries is limited. We explored the question of democratization by investigating whether females from different countries were more likely to enroll in and complete STEM MOOCs compared with males. We found that whereas females were less likely to enroll in STEM MOOCs, they were equally likely to complete them. We found smaller gender gaps in STEM MOOC enrollment in less economically developed countries. Further, females were more likely than males to complete STEM MOOCs in countries identified as having a high potential to become the largest economies in the 21st century.
